Plan B® is the emergency contraceptive pill, most trusted by Canadian women † and their healthcare providers. Plan B® contains 1.5 mg of levonorgestrel—an ingredient that is also commonly found in birth control pills.

WebEllaOne. 1 Tablet. £30.00. ellaOne is a “morning after” pill for emergency contraception, for use up to five days after sex. ellaOne is the most effective pill, and if it is suitable for you only one tablet is required. Levonelle. 1 Tablet. £26.49. Levonelle is a “morning after” pill for emergency contraception, for use up to 72 hours ...
